Beware of Hell's creatures, they bite.


I've had to hide my whole life from Lucifer and other demons who either want me dead or enslaved for being a succubus. Forced to run and never get close to people. I had one close friend, her cousin, and my brother, Zar. But it was still a lonely life.

Zar and I were surviving just fine until the Light Soul Counsel changed everything. They declared all supernaturals with demon blood to be labeled Dark Souls and sent back to Hell.

First, I lost my brother. Then, they captured me. Now, I lived in a demon academy in Hell named Dark Souls Academy. Go Figure.

I've had to fight every second since getting here, and surviving a demon horde wasn't fucking easy. Do I get a break? Nope.

I saved too many people and denied the horde their sacrificed flesh, so the Dark Counsel, which is led by Lucifer, is coming here to decide what will be the consequence. That can mean a slap on the wrist, or it can mean death. Whatever happens next, I'm done pushing people away. I need to claim my men and create a faction. Well, I will if I'm not sentenced to death, that is. But I have a feeling I won't be able to keep everyone alive this time.

If that isn't enough, there are three dangerous men who I need to stay away from. Not just because they're Lucifer’s sons, but they're also off limits. My demon side doesn't care. My morals do, though. A lot is going to happen within these few days. I just hope I can handle it.




Urban Fantasy 18+
This is a full-length, FAST PACED, Why Choose Paranormal Romance novel. There are Trigger Warnings. This book takes place in Hell, with demons. So, it contains violence, adult language, and strong conduct. There's also physical and sexual abuse, murders, mental health disorders, illnesses, and second character cheating, and ends on a cliffhanger. The FMC has a hero complex and fights her feelings. So, she may cause you some frustration. Also, be warned that Ivy is a self-sacrificing character, almost to the point of naivety.

Book two is all about change. Personalities may change and become darker. They have had to suppress who they really are, so they don't even know themselves.

About the author

Tosha Y. Miller

15 books76 followers
Tosha spends most of her days reading and writing. She loves anything fantasy and swears her black cat, Xena, is secretly a shifter. Tosha wants Xena to steal her away from the human world, but she’s playing the slow game. She’ll just have to butter her up by letting her sleep on her chest some more. 
One day, she’ll get to dance in the dark with real supernaturals. Until then, she’ll keep writing stories about strong women and sexy men with powers.
